About

In 2023, Mount Kisco, NY had a population of 10.8k people with a median age of 40.1 and a median household income of $93,057. Between 2022 and 2023 the population of Mount Kisco, NY declined from 10,835 to 10,782, a −0.489% decrease and its median household income declined from $99,444 to $93,057, a −6.42% decrease.

The 5 largest ethnic groups in Mount Kisco, NY are White (Non-Hispanic) (50%), Other (Hispanic) (20.8%), White (Hispanic) (9.18%), Two+ (Hispanic) (8.01%), and Black or African American (Non-Hispanic) (4.46%).

None of the households in Mount Kisco, NY reported speaking a non-English language at home as their primary shared language. This does not consider the potential multi-lingual nature of households, but only the primary self-reported language spoken by all members of the household.

86.3% of the residents in Mount Kisco, NY are U.S. citizens.

The largest universities in Mount Kisco, NY are Yeshiva of Nitra Rabbinical College (197674) (30 degrees awarded in 2022).

In 2023, the median property value in Mount Kisco, NY was $485,800, and the homeownership rate was 66.4%.

Most people in Mount Kisco, NY drove alone to work, and the average commute time was 32.7 minutes. The average car ownership in Mount Kisco, NY was 2 cars per household.

Economy

The economy of Mount Kisco, NY employs 5.33k people. The largest industries in Mount Kisco, NY are Educational Services (825 people), Health Care & Social Assistance (638 people), and Retail Trade (536 people), and the highest paying industries are Utilities ($131,172), Transportation & Warehousing, & Utilities ($130,438), and Public Administration ($127,188).

Males in New York have an average income that is 1.27 times higher than the average income of females, which is $77,694. The income inequality in New York (measured using the Gini index) is 0.494, which is higher than than the national average.

Housing & Living

The median property value in Mount Kisco, NY was $485,800 in 2023, which is 1.6 times larger than the national average of $303,400. Between 2022 and 2023 the median property value increased from $506,400 to $485,800, a 4.07% decrease. The homeownership rate in Mount Kisco, NY is 66.4%, which is approximately the same as the national average of 65%.

People in Mount Kisco, NY have an average commute time of 32.7 minutes, and they drove alone to work. Car ownership in Mount Kisco, NY is approximately the same as the national average, with an average of 2 cars per household.

Poverty & Diversity

9.3% of the population for whom poverty status is determined in Mount Kisco, NY (1k out of 10.8k people) live below the poverty line, a number that is lower than the national average of 12.4%. The largest demographic living in poverty are Males 55 - 64, followed by Females 65 - 74 and then Females 45 - 54.

The most common racial or ethnic group living below the poverty line in Mount Kisco, NY is Hispanic, followed by White and Other.

The Census Bureau uses a set of money income thresholds that vary by family size and composition to determine who classifies as impoverished. If a family's total income is less than the family's threshold than that family and every individual in it is considered to be living in poverty.

Health

93.7% of the population of Mount Kisco, NY has health coverage, with 43.8% on employee plans, 22.9% on Medicaid, 10.8% on Medicare, 16% on non-group plans, and 0.204% on military or VA plans.

Primary care physicians in Westchester County, NY see 721 patients per year on average, which represents a 0.414% decrease from the previous year (724 patients). Compare this to dentists who see 927 patients per year, and mental health providers who see 232 patients per year.
